Overview
Flameproof Insulated Explosion-Proof Tanks are engineered to mitigate risks associated with volatile substances in industrial settings. These vessels integrate flame-retardant barriers and thermal insulation to prevent chain reactions from external sparks or internal pressure buildup. Their design complies with international safety standards such as ATEX Directive 2014/34/EU and IECEx for hazardous area equipment. Common applications include storing petrochemicals, liquid fuels, and reactive monomers where traditional containers would pose significant explosion hazards. Manufacturers often customize tanks with additional features like pressure sensors, emergency venting systems, and corrosion-resistant linings based on the stored material's properties.
Structure and Working Principle
The tank typically consists of three core layers: an inner corrosion-resistant shell (often stainless steel), a middle flame-arresting filler (e.g., ceramic microspheres), and an outer protective jacket. The insulation layer maintains stable internal temperatures while the flameproof design disrupts combustion propagation through narrow-passage geometries. Pressure relief mechanisms activate at predetermined thresholds (commonly 2–10 bar) to vent gases safely. Advanced models may include double-welded seams and conductive grounding strips to dissipate static electricity. The working principle relies on passive safety – containing reactions without external energy input – though some variants incorporate active cooling systems for high-risk scenarios.
Key Features
Superior thermal insulation performance reduces heat transfer by 70–90% compared to conventional tanks, critical for maintaining substance stability. The flame arrestor technology can withstand direct flame impingement for 90–120 minutes in standard tests. Other notable features include: seismic-resistant bracing for earthquake-prone areas, RFID tags for inventory tracking, and modular designs allowing stackable configurations. The interior often features smooth polishing (Ra ≤ 0.8μm) to prevent material accumulation and facilitate cleaning. Optional accessories include nitrogen blanketing systems for oxygen-sensitive compounds and remote monitoring interfaces.
Application Areas
Primary industries utilizing these tanks include petrochemical refineries for intermediate product storage, pharmaceutical plants handling solvent recovery, and mining operations for emulsion explosives. They're also deployed in aerospace fuel depots and nuclear waste containment where secondary containment is mandatory. Specialized variants serve niche markets: epoxy-lined tanks for acidic compounds, cryogenic-insulated models for liquefied gases, and mobile skid-mounted units for temporary field operations. The growing hydrogen economy has spurred demand for tanks with enhanced permeation barriers to prevent H2 leakage.
Maintenance and Precautions
Monthly inspections should verify insulation integrity (no wet spots or compaction), weld seam conditions, and pressure relief device functionality. Hydrostatic testing every 3–5 years is recommended for tanks handling pressurized contents. Critical precautions include: never exceeding the Maximum Allowable Working Pressure (MAWP), ensuring proper grounding before filling operations, and using only compatible cleaning agents. Insulation materials require periodic moisture checks – dampness can reduce effectiveness by up to 60%. Always follow the manufacturer's guidelines for repair procedures; unauthorized modifications may void explosion-proof certifications.
B2B Procurement Guide
When sourcing these tanks, prioritize suppliers with documented quality management systems (ISO 9001) and explosion protection certifications (e.g., ATEX Category 1). Key evaluation criteria should include: design life expectancy (typically 15–25 years), availability of spare parts, and after-sales technical support. For bulk procurement (10+ units), negotiate clauses for factory acceptance testing (FAT) and performance warranties. Consider total cost of ownership – premium materials like duplex stainless steel may offer better lifecycle economics despite higher upfront costs. Lead times generally range from 8–20 weeks for custom configurations; plan inventory accordingly.
